Beatrix Hoyt

Hoyt, Beatrix

Golf

b. 1880, Westchester County, NY

d. Aug. 14, 1963

At sixteen, Hoyt won the U. S. Women's Amateur championship in 1896, the first year she entered. She was the youngest champion until Laura Baugh won in 1971.

Hoyt also won the title in 1897 and 1898; she's one of only four golfers to win three amateur championships in a row. She was low scorer in the tournament's qualifying round five years in a row, 1896-1900.

Hoyt retired from serious competition after losing in the semi-finals of the 1900 tournament.
